Output ec0efc69864d196d8d41af57b65bf455f17f565f539fd08fad8ed5f77c2919de:1

value
43200
script pubkey
OP_0 OP_PUSHBYTES_20 68210e17bdab9293385ea12c882c29177f961bcd
address
bc1qdqssu9aa4wffxwz75ykgstpfzalevx7dwj505q
transaction
ec0efc69864d196d8d41af57b65bf455f17f565f539fd08fad8ed5f77c2919de
confirmations
201238
spent
true